Transaction dde4e8136968a285fe2c4adf7e40da24a2ec79e61034218cc5edef674de18e70
1 Input
1 Output
-
dde4e8136968a285fe2c4adf7e40da24a2ec79e61034218cc5edef674de18e70:0
- value
- 17436
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 37a3857c6d4240d33350b3f6577cf7bb440e808bbb6ac62a5d004b8c2563170e
- address
- bc1px73c2lrdgfqdxv6sk0m9wl8hhdzqaqythd4vv2jaqp9ccftrzu8qsxd5u8